- Ethel Broadhurst was born in April 1897 in Connecticut, USA. She was an actress, known for Soft Pedal (1926), Loose Change (1922) and Good Morning, Judge (1922). She was married to Raymond John Hollis, Bedford Broadhurst and Whitcomb. She died on August 29, 1945 in Los Angeles, California, USA.

- A former Broadway-chorine, who was one of the "Vanity-fair maidens", she appeared in a few comedies with actor Eddie Boland.
- Although her Los Angeles marriage license gives her birth place as New York she was really born in Connecticut.
- Daughter of John Mcdevett(Mcdevitt) and Helen (Nellie) Fruin.
- Although her death certificate state that she was born 1907,the 1900 census shows her birth date as 1897.
